Type
ORACLE
Validation date
2024-11-24 20:16: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02039,
    "usd": 0.02134
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001636A2C621AE163E14ABCC459FCFDF83D9A1C4FF926E66B94BBA380D220BAE0C7

Previous signature

5C33676659FEEA4F17734A7624B54BC8D91E1F6FAE1AC70533401E9D04653BFCF8446A13ADC5B1DE96D3E5E75D34945D35CEFEC78F60CA6AD1BD87F1FBC46100

Origin signature

304502210083D497C1E92A8F8D8D966DCE89797ABBCB5E163DC23D8209485403058B8F0652022019395BA5F099B79AA23A180E73E4FA42C7AA6FEE199A736FDA02C51AE277630B

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

008C593324F57ABA6B975A2996FFF112E27B5A393057064282B103E51BD93AD1DF

Coordinator signature

A710D86D751931C9D820040FC4467FBDEC005ECD68374C47C927050B107437CE3A850DAE322EC4C4883B3D4A608DAC08CFA0CAC6A3813B5CC4AAD373D6FC7503

Validator #1 public key

00016204A6DD6BA17388994E74A6529F509D1479FEFB67D8D55D1E450E30A30982D2

Validator #1 signature

7CD890D0E21952E163E6659D22D68779AFBF73E60E4D2FAA55B084573967CA86F3CAA2ED06767C26E9AF6E47B00CC4D083F2A8EA3C76FE6FAF95220D2F2B180F

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

AD251F90F847BF72FCF95D097889C6EDEF21824502A51CD51BA86822CD9662C1D2C6439174BAE703B338DD0AE423DC10D2F5BE5780390583186473063A05960C